Etymology
Yairely is a modern feminine given name of uncertain etymology, though it appears to be a creative variation or invention, possibly blending elements from Spanish or English phonetics without a clear linguistic root in established languages. The name is used primarily in Spanish-speaking communities, particularly in Latin America, and lacks significant historical context or religious association, representing contemporary naming trends rather than traditional cultural heritage.
Yairely currently ranks #17,890 in the United States as a girl's name. It reached its peak popularity around 2001.
